I’m not sure if they were regionals, but two other bad ones were the generic "Beer" that came in the white cans with black lettering. And Billy Beer. Mid- to late ’70s?

"Beer" was usually brewed by Falstaff or a Falstaff-owned company in the Midwest, and by Lucky (and other breweries owned by Paul Kalmanovitz) on the West Coast. Not sure about the East Coast.
"Billy" was supposedly brewed to the stringent standards of one Billy Carter of Plains, GA. [;)] Four different companies actually produced it; here in the Midwest in came from Falls City and down South Pearl was the brewer, but the other 2 escape me at the moment.
